As of release JDK 5, this class has been supplemented with an equivalent class designed for use by a single thread, StringBuilder. The StringBuilder c...
分类:
其他好文 时间:
2015-05-29 00:37:21
阅读次数:
135
import java.lang.StringBuilder; public class Stringadd { ?public static void method1() { ??String[] name = { "嘿嘿", "嘻", "等等等" }; ??StringBuffer sb = new StringBuffer(); ??for (int i = ...
分类:
编程语言 时间:
2015-05-28 11:06:02
阅读次数:
168
一、图解String类创建对象及赋值面试题:二、String、StringBuffer、StringBuilder区别 1、String内容不可变,而StringBuffer、StringBuilder都是内容可变的 2、StringBuffer是同步的,数据安全,效率低;StringBuild.....
分类:
编程语言 时间:
2015-05-28 09:19:48
阅读次数:
192
StringBuffer特点:是字符串缓冲区.是一个容器,其长度可变,可以操作添加多个数据类型.最后通过toString方法变成字符串.被final锁修饰,因此不能被继承.存储:方法1:append() 添加数据到缓冲区.返回类型:StringBuffer方法: append(指定数据) 将指定数据...
分类:
编程语言 时间:
2015-05-27 21:05:57
阅读次数:
153
StringBuffer1、StringBuffer 和 String 并无直接关系
2、StringBuffer 避免了Sring内容改变时产生垃圾的现象。
3、一个StringBuffer对象可以调用toString()方法转换为String对象。
下面通过一个小例子演示StringBuffer类的相关方法:package StringBuffer;
public class String...
分类:
编程语言 时间:
2015-05-27 10:22:37
阅读次数:
157
创建StringBuffer类以及toString,append()方法 //创建一个StringBuffer类 ,此类有两个方法:一个是append方法一个是toString方法 function StringBuffer() { this.__strings__ = []; ...
分类:
Web程序 时间:
2015-05-26 21:00:23
阅读次数:
199
Java BufferedReader下载网络文件
使用java BufferedReader从网络中读取文件到本地,可以存入数据库,也可以保存到本地
java代码1.下载网络文件内容转换成StringBuffer/** 从网络地址url下载文件读成字符串
* @param downloadUrl 文件的网络地址
* @return...
分类:
编程语言 时间:
2015-05-26 14:25:05
阅读次数:
446
1、String
用于存放字符的数组被声明为final的,因此只能赋值一次,不可再更改。这就导致每次对String的操作都会生成新的String对象,不仅效率低下,而且大量浪费有限的内存空间。
String a ="a"; //假设a指向地址0x0001
a ="b";//重新赋值后a指向地址0x0002,但0x0001地址中保存的"a"依旧存在,但已经不再是a所指向的,a 已经指向了其它...
分类:
其他好文 时间:
2015-05-26 09:12:23
阅读次数:
137
/** * 根据搜索条件查询商品(带缓存) */ public List getSearchGoodsList(GoodsTypeCondtionBizBean condition, QueryPage queryPage){ StringBuffer sb = new StringBuff...
分类:
其他好文 时间:
2015-05-25 22:20:15
阅读次数:
348
问题:
在c中字符间转化可以以char a=char(b+5);的方式,但在java中却没用,这里给出一种转化方法:int c=b+5;char a=char(c);
String字符串,倒过来:
StringBffer str=new StringBuffer(s);
s=str.reverse().toString();
在测试时加入了一些输出语句,和一些小改动,在输出时忘记改回...
分类:
编程语言 时间:
2015-05-25 10:04:57
阅读次数:
137